7. I'LL DANCE A JIG AND I'LL DANCE NO MORE

Found in HillCountryTunes.abc from the John Chambers' music books abc collection

X: 8
T: 7. I'LL DANCE A JIG AND I'LL DANCE NO MORE
B: Sam Bayard, "Hill Country Tunes" 1944 #7
S: Played by Mrs Sarah Armstrong, (near) Derry, PA, Nov 18 1943.
R: jig
Z: 2010 John Chambers <jc:trillian.mit.edu>
M: 6/8
L: 1/8
K: Amix
Bcd |\
e2e efe | d2B G2A | B2B BAG | AAA Bcd |
e2e efe | d2B G2A | Bcd A2F | A2z z2c/d/ |
e2e ef^/g | a2f d3 | ef^/g e2c | e3- e2c/d/ |
e2e ef^/g | a2f d3 | ef^/g e2c | e2z z2c/d/ |
e2e efe | d2B G2A | B2B BAG | A2"D.C."z |]
